Key Points

  • Shares gapped up premarket after results showed signs of a turnaround—adjusted EBITDA rose ~38% and management reported narrowing losses, expanded margins from store rationalizations and cost actions, plus new promotions aimed at boosting traffic.
  • Offsetting risks include a GAAP EPS miss (loss $0.05 vs. ~$0.03 expected) and ~2.2% YoY revenue decline due to store closures and the end of a McDonald’s arrangement, along with conservative FY‑2026 revenue guidance (~$1.3–$1.4B) and mixed analyst ratings (consensus "Hold", $4.42 target).

Krispy Kreme, Inc. (NASDAQ:DNUT - Get Free Report) shares gapped up before the market opened on Thursday . The stock had previously closed at $3.68, but opened at $4.03. Krispy Kreme shares last traded at $3.6150, with a volume of 1,428,009 shares traded.

Wall Street Analyst Weigh In

DNUT has been the subject of several analyst reports. Zacks Research upgraded Krispy Kreme from a "hold" rating to a "strong-buy" rating in a report on Friday, March 27th. Weiss Ratings restated a "sell (d)" rating on shares of Krispy Kreme in a report on Friday, March 27th. Wall Street Zen upgraded Krispy Kreme from a "sell" rating to a "hold" rating in a report on Sunday, February 22nd. Capital One Financial upgraded Krispy Kreme from an "equal weight" rating to an "overweight" rating and set a $6.00 target price for the company in a research report on Thursday, March 26th. Finally, Morgan Stanley restated an "underweight" rating and set a $3.00 price objective on shares of Krispy Kreme in a research report on Tuesday, January 20th.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, three have assigned a Buy rating, three have issued a Hold rating and three have given a Sell r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the company presently has a consensus rating of "Hold" and a consensus target price of $4.42.

Krispy Kreme Stock Down 1.1%

The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.40, a quick ratio of 0.32 and a current ratio of 0.38. The company has a market cap of $627.46 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-1.20 and a beta of 1.32. The stock's fifty day moving average is $3.52 and its two-hundred day moving average is $3.71.

Krispy Kreme (NASDAQ:DNUT -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, February 26th. The company reported $0.09 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.03 by $0.06. Krispy Kreme had a negative net margin of 33.87% and a negative return on equity of 3.66%. The firm had revenue of $392.37 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$386.72 million.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$0.01 EPS. The company's revenue for the quarter was down 2.9% on a year-over-year basis. Sell-side analysts predict that Krispy Kreme, Inc. will post -0.01 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Krispy Kreme Company Profile

Krispy Kreme Doughnuts, Inc NASDAQ: DNUT is a global retailer and wholesaler renowned for its signature Original Glazed doughnut and a variety of other sweet treats. The company operates through a combination of company-owned stores, franchise outlets and strategic partnerships with supermarkets, convenience stores and other foodservice channels. In addition to its doughnut portfolio, Krispy Kreme offers freshly brewed coffee, assorted beverages and proprietary seasonal items designed to drive traffic and foster brand loyalty.

Founded in 1937 in Winston-Salem, North Carolina, by Vernon Rudolph, Krispy Kreme has grown from a single local shop to a multinational brand.
